Hi. As the electric field inside a conductor is zero. The electrostatic potential is constant inside it. The potential at centre will be the potential of entire conductor. The entire charge of conductor is on surface. Note that despite induced charges, net charge will be zero. Thus the net potential at centre is kQ/r (due to surface charge) + kq/2r (due to the point charge) Q=0Thus potential is kq/2r= 9 Volts
